Girls’ Organic Cotton Half Apron Review
The kids love cooking and making stuff in the kitchen. Usually, their clothes have more food and flour on them they actually ended up in the bowl. They show just how much they enjoyed making their creations. The girls especially love when they get to help because they feel like “big” girls.
Girls’ Organic Cotton Half Apron is an organic cotton kids aprons. My girls loved wearing them while helping us make their favorite cookies. Alexandria had to wear it even when she was setting the table, cleaning off the table. Even when she was deciding what she wanted for snack! Cheyenne wanted to put her trains inside the pockets so that she was sure she wouldn’t lose them and they would always be within hands reach.
I love the fact that our Girls’ Organic Cotton Half Apron is cut and sewn in the USA by family-owned Tailoredwear, Inc, these aprons are made for A Greener Kitchen using fabric sourced from Harmony Art, one of the USA’s few eco-friendly textile artisans. The safer for our environment the better. The fabric is so soft and light weight. They are so easy to wash in cold water. But remember for the lowest impact on the environment, hand wash or wash these aprons for kids in cold water using an eco-friendly detergent and hang to dry.
